How Do I Send Money With SWIFT Code BPPBCHGG12A?

BPPBCHGG12A is a SWIFT (the Society for Worldwide Interbank Financial Telecommunication) Code of BNP PARIBAS (SUISSE) SA located in Geneva, Switzerland. If you want to transfer funds from Geneva to abroad. You will need this SWIFT Code BPPBCHGG12A.

If you want to send money with SWIFT Code BPPBCHGG12A, go for an international wire transfer. You can do it by internet banking, authentic online platforms or by visiting the BNP PARIBAS (SUISSE) SA. Provide recipient details including the Recipient’s name, the name of the bank & branch, the purpose of transfer, the recipient’s SWIFT Code, and the amount you want to transfer. Also, provide your SWIFT Code: BPPBCHGG12A. Completed the required forms and confirmed fees. Now, initiate the transfer through your bank BNP PARIBAS (SUISSE) SA. Lastly, track the transfer using the provided reference number and wait for the confirmation.
